Governor Mark Dayton has named a member of the Olmsted County Board to a new state task force.

Sheila Kiscaden is among the 12 Minnesotans appointed by the Governor to serve on the Task Force on Health Care Financing. The panel of health care experts will begin meeting next month to analyze and recommend options involving the future of state health care programs, including MNsure and MinnesotaCare.

The task force will also include the commissioners of the Minnesota Commerce and Health and Human Services Departments, the Executive director of MNSure and legislative appointees.

They are expected to have a final report ready for the Governor and state legislature in mid-January.
